Our top picks close to this hotel

For families

Ripley’s Believe It Or Not plays host to over 700 weird and wonderful spectacles. It’s guaranteed to keep kids entertained for a few hours.

For romance

For a date with a difference, why not enjoy a game of tennis in the leafy and tranquil Hyde Park? You can hire balls and racquets, so it’s easy and cost effective.

For culture

The British Museum is dedicated to human history and culture. It houses over 8 million works and entrance is entirely free.

For shopping

If you love designer labels, pay a visit to Liberty. A department store full of stylish clothes, sumptuous fabrics and high-end make up, shoppers will absolutely love it.

For eating out

Polpo in Soho is the latest place to be seen. Share a few plates of the simple yet delicious food, including the fantastic chickpea and anchovy mash.

For nightlife

Punk in Soho is a favourite amongst the cool crowd. Spinning a soundtrack of electro and 90s’ pop, it’s worth a visit if you’d like to explore London’s varied nightlife.
